The practice of chemical castration, a controversial and often questioned method of suppressing sexual urges through hormonal manipulation, has been steadily gaining ground in the United States. While its origins can be traced to the mid-20th century, its use in recent years has risen, raising profound ethical questions. Proponents claim that chemical castration offers a humane alternative to incarceration for individuals convicted of gruesome offenses. However, critics express deep reservations about its potential for abuse and the breach of human rights it poses.
- Moreover, the long-term consequences of chemical castration remain largely unknown, adding another layer of complexity to this thorny issue.

Chemical Castration: A Violation of Human Rights in the U.S.?
The debate surrounding chemical castration in the United States is a sensitive one, raising serious concerns about human rights. Supporters argue that it can be an effective tool for rehabilitation, particularly in cases involving violent crimes. Conversely, critics reject it as a form of cruel and unusual punishment, violating fundamental rights. The use of chemical castration frequently involves injecting hormones that suppress testosterone production, with the objective of reducing sexual motivation. This practice has been adopted in some U.S. states for certain offenses, but its legality remains a subject of continuous litigation.
- Many scholars argue that chemical castration violates the Eighth Amendment's prohibition against cruel and unusual punishment.
- Furthermore, critics point out that it can have severe side effects, including emotional distress
- In essence, the question of whether chemical castration constitutes a violation of human rights in the U.S. is a difficult one with no easy answers.
